A street vendor is an individual who sells goods or services on the streets, sidewalks, or public spaces. They typically operate from temporary stalls, carts, or stands, engaging with potential customers passing by. Street vendors offer a wide range of products, including food items such as snacks, beverages, fruits, and local delicacies. They may also sell clothing, accessories, handmade crafts, artwork, books, or provide services like shoe shining or hair braiding. Street vendors play a vital role in the local economy, often catering to a specific demographic or neighborhood. Their occupation requires strong interpersonal skills to attract customers, negotiate prices, and provide a pleasant shopping experience. They must be adaptable, able to work in various weather conditions, and possess basic business acumen to manage inventory, pricing, and finances.

Street Vendor salary in United Kingdom
Average Yearly Salary of Street Vendor in United Kingdom is approximately 18,899 GBP (22,297 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.
